CMS 3D CMS Logo

EcalSimParametersFromDD.h
Go to the documentation of this file.
1 #ifndef EcalCommonData_EcalSimParametersFromDD_h
2 #define EcalCommonData_EcalSimParametersFromDD_h
3 
8 #include <string>
9 #include <vector>
10 
11 class DDFilteredView;
13 
15 public:
16  EcalSimParametersFromDD() = default;
17 
20 
21 private:
23  std::vector<std::string> getStringArray(const std::string&, const DDsvalues_type&);
24  std::vector<double> getDDDArray(const std::string&, const DDsvalues_type&);
25 };
26 
27 #endif
std::vector< std::string > getStringArray(const std::string &, const DDsvalues_type &)
Compact representation of the geometrical detector hierarchy.
Definition: DDCompactView.h:81
std::vector< std::pair< unsigned int, DDValue > > DDsvalues_type
Definition: DDsvalues.h:12
bool build(const DDCompactView *, const std::string &name, EcalSimulationParameters &)
std::vector< double > getDDDArray(const std::string &, const DDsvalues_type &)
EcalSimParametersFromDD()=default
bool buildParameters(const EcalSimulationParameters &)